AstraZeneca Vaccine: Bangladesh to get 5m doses from Poland, KSA

Vials labelled "Astra Zeneca COVID-19 Coronavirus Vaccine" and a syringe are seen in front of a displayed AstraZeneca logo, in this illustration photo taken March 14, 2021. Photo: Reuters

Foreign Minister AK Abdul Momen has said Bangladesh will soon receive around 5 million AstraZeneca Covid-19 vaccine doses from Poland and Saudi Arabia as gift.

Bangladesh will get around 1.5 million doses of the vaccine from Saudi Arabia.

"Our ambassador in Riyadh has informed me that 1499,270 doses of AstraZeneca vaccine will come from the King Salman Relief Fund," Momen said in a message from Paris yesterday.

The vaccine doses will arrive in Dhaka by the next two to three days, the minister said.

Poland will provide 3.3 million AstraZeneca vaccine doses to Bangladesh free of cost, he said, adding that these are being shipped. Poland donated these vaccine doses through the European Union.
